Output ed32d5cdea7c5fcc2a3cdb153c6be0a16e1c6826f06c9d56a71913ee48cb25e1:3

value
599900000
script pubkey
OP_0 OP_PUSHBYTES_20 eaa69bc63a96debbd97249126ed044dcc8790a67
address
ltc1qa2nfh336jm0thktjfyfxa5zymny8jzn84e6nme
transaction
ed32d5cdea7c5fcc2a3cdb153c6be0a16e1c6826f06c9d56a71913ee48cb25e1
spent
true